IMS で構成された AI エージェントインスタンスを起動します。
操作説明
この API を使用して、設定済みの AI エージェントインスタンスを起動し、チャットに参加させることができます。エージェント ID (AIAgentId)、ランタイム構成 (RuntimeConfig)、およびオプションでテンプレート構成 (TemplateConfig) とユーザー定義データ (UserData) を指定します。AI エージェントインスタンスが正常に起動すると、API は追跡またはさらなる操作のための一意の InstanceId を返します。
今すぐお試しください
テスト
RAM 認証
|
アクション |
アクセスレベル |
リソースタイプ |
条件キー |
依存アクション |
|
ice:StartAIAgentInstance |
none |
*All Resource
|
なし | なし |
リクエストパラメーター
|
パラメーター |
型 |
必須 / 任意 |
説明 |
例 |
| AIAgentId |
string |
必須 |
IMS コンソールで設定されたエージェント ID。 |
39f8e0bc005e4f309379701645f4**** |
| RuntimeConfig | AIAgentRuntimeConfig |
必須 |
ランタイム時にエージェントに必要な構成。 |
|
| AgentConfig | AIAgentConfig |
任意 |
エージェントのテンプレート構成。指定する値は、コンソールで設定されたテンプレート構成とマージされます。このパラメーターを省略した場合、エージェントはコンソールからのデフォルト構成を使用します。 説明
このフィールドは TemplateConfig と互換性があります。AgentConfig のフィールドが優先されます。TemplateConfig に AgentConfig で定義されていないフィールドが含まれている場合、それらのフィールドが使用されます。TemplateConfig の代わりに AgentConfig を使用してください。 |
|
| UserData |
string |
任意 |
ユーザー定義データ。 |
{"Email":"johndoe@example.com","Preferences":{"Language":"en"}} |
| SessionId |
string |
任意 |
チャットセッションの一意の識別子。このパラメーターはオプションです。 |
f213fbc005e4f309379701645f4**** |
| ChatSyncConfig |
object |
任意 |
チャット履歴同期構成。 |
|
| IMAIAgentId |
string |
任意 |
IM エージェント ID。 |
******005e4f309379701645f4**** |
| ReceiverId |
string |
任意 |
受信者ユーザー ID。 |
4167626d312034b2b1c3b7f2f3e41884 |
TemplateConfig
deprecated
|
AIAgentTemplateConfig |
任意 |
エージェントのテンプレート構成。指定する値は、コンソールで設定されたテンプレート構成とマージされます。このパラメーターを省略した場合、エージェントはコンソールからのデフォルト構成を使用します。 説明
エージェントのテンプレート構成。このフィールドは非推奨です。AgentConfig フィールドをご参照ください。 |
レスポンスフィールド
|
フィールド |
型 |
説明 |
例 |
|
object |
応答のスキーマ |
||
| RequestId |
string |
リクエスト ID。 |
7B117AF5-2A16-412C-B127-FA6175ED1AD0 |
| InstanceId |
string |
AI エージェントインスタンスの一意の ID。 |
39f8e0bc005e4f309379701645f4**** |
例
成功レスポンス
JSONJSON
{
"RequestId": "7B117AF5-2A16-412C-B127-FA6175ED1AD0",
"InstanceId": "39f8e0bc005e4f309379701645f4****"
}
エラーコード
完全なリストについては、「エラーコード」をご参照ください。
変更履歴
完全なリストについては、「変更履歴」をご参照ください。